سبد دانلود 0

تگ های موضوع سیستم ورود و عضویت

سیستم ورود و عضویت در وب‌سایت‌ها و برنامه‌های کاربردی، یکی از مهم‌ترین و حیاتی‌ترین بخش‌های هر سامانه آنلاین محسوب می‌شود. این سیستم‌ها نه تنها نقش کلیدی در امنیت و حفاظت از داده‌های کاربران دارند، بلکه ارتباط میان کاربر و پلتفرم را تسهیل می‌کنند. در این مقاله، به طور جامع و کامل، به بررسی جزئیات، عملکردها، انواع، و چالش‌های مربوط به سیستم‌های ورود و عضویت می‌پردازیم.


مقدمه: اهمیت سیستم ورود و عضویت
در دنیای دیجیتال امروز، هر سایت یا برنامه‌ای نیازمند یک سیستم ورود و عضویت است. تصور کنید، بدون این سیستم، کاربر نمی‌تواند به اطلاعات شخصی، سفارش‌ها، یا امکانات خاص دسترسی پیدا کند. بنابراین، این سیستم‌ها نقش دروازه‌بان را دارند که اجازه می‌دهند فقط کاربران مجاز بتوانند وارد سیستم شوند و از خدمات آن بهره‌مند گردند. علاوه بر این، سیستم‌های ورود و عضویت، فرصت‌هایی برای جمع‌آوری داده‌های ارزشمند درباره کاربران فراهم می‌کنند، که این داده‌ها می‌تواند در استراتژی‌های بازاریابی، بهبود خدمات، و تحلیل رفتار کاربران به کار رود.
انواع سیستم‌های ورود و عضویت
در حال حاضر، چند نوع اصلی از سیستم‌های ورود و عضویت وجود دارد که هر کدام ویژگی‌ها و مزایای خاص خود را دارند:
1. سیستم‌های سنتی (ایمیل و رمز عبور): این نوع، رایج‌ترین و پایه‌ترین روش است. کاربر باید ایمیل خود را وارد کند و سپس یک رمز عبور ایجاد یا وارد کند. این روش، ساده و قابل فهم است، ولی امنیت آن به شدت وابسته به قدرت رمز عبور است.
2. ورود با شبکه‌های اجتماعی: در این روش، کاربران می‌توانند از طریق حساب‌های کاربری در شبکه‌هایی مانند فیس‌بوک، گوگل، یا توییتر وارد شوند. این نوع، سریع و راحت است و نیاز به ثبت‌نام مجدد ندارد، اما مسائل مربوط به حریم خصوصی و امنیت را نیز به همراه دارد.
3. ورود بیومتریک: با پیشرفت فناوری، سیستم‌های بیومتریک مانند اثر انگشت، تشخیص چهره، و اسکن عنبیه چشم، در حال گسترش هستند. این روش‌ها، سطح امنیت را بسیار بالا می‌برند، اما هزینه پیاده‌سازی و نیاز به سخت‌افزار خاص، ممکن است محدودیت‌هایی ایجاد کند.
4. ورود با رمز یک‌بار مصرف (OTP): در این روش، پس از وارد کردن ایمیل یا شماره تلفن، یک کد موقت ارسال می‌شود که کاربر باید آن را وارد کند تا فرآیند ورود تکمیل شود. این روش، امنیت بالایی دارد و برای تایید هویت کاربر بسیار موثر است.
فرایند ثبت‌نام و ورود
فرآیند ثبت‌نام و ورود در سیستم‌های مختلف ممکن است تفاوت‌هایی داشته باشد، ولی اصول کلی آن‌ها تقریبا مشترک است:
- ثبت‌نام: کاربر باید اطلاعات اولیه مانند نام، ایمیل، شماره تلفن، و در برخی موارد، اطلاعات دیگر را وارد کند. پس از آن، سیستم معمولاً ایمیل یا شماره تلفن کاربر را تایید می‌کند تا صحت آن‌ها اثبات شود. این مرحله، اهمیت زیادی دارد چون پایه و اساس امنیت حساب کاربری است.
- ورود: کاربر باید اطلاعات وارد شده در فرآیند ثبت‌نام را وارد کند یا از طریق روش‌های جایگزین مانند شبکه‌های اجتماعی یا بیومتریک، وارد سیستم شود. پس از تایید هویت، کاربر به صفحه مورد نظر هدایت می‌شود.
- مدیریت حساب کاربری: پس از ورود، کاربر می‌تواند اطلاعات شخصی خود را ویرایش کند، رمز عبور را تغییر دهد، یا تنظیمات مربوط به حریم خصوصی و اعلان‌ها را مدیریت کند.
امنیت در سیستم‌های ورود و عضویت
امنیت، یکی از مهم‌ترین چالش‌های این سیستم‌ها است. حملات سایبری متعددی مانند فیشینگ، حملات بروت فورس، و هک‌های حساب کاربری، همواره تهدیدی جدی محسوب می‌شوند. بنابراین، پیاده‌سازی روش‌های امنیتی قوی و استانداردهای جهانی الزامی است. برخی از این روش‌ها عبارتند از:
- استفاده از رمز عبور قوی: رمزهای عبور باید حداقل ۱۲ کاراکتر داشته باشند و ترکیبی از حروف بزرگ و کوچک، اعداد، و نمادها باشند.
- احراز هویت دو مرحله‌ای (2FA): این روش، لایه امنیتی اضافی است که پس از ورود اولیه، نیازمند تایید هویت از طریق پیامک، ایمیل، یا برنامه‌های مخصوص است.
- نظارت بر فعالیت‌های مشکوک: سیستم باید بتواند فعالیت‌های غیرعادی مانند تلاش‌های متعدد برای ورود ناموفق را تشخیص دهد و اقدامات لازم را انجام دهد.
- رمزگذاری داده‌ها: تمامی داده‌های حساس باید با پروتکل‌های رمزگذاری مناسب محافظت شوند، تا در صورت نفوذ، اطلاعات کاربر در معرض خطر قرار نگیرد.
چالش‌ها و راهکارهای رایج
علی‌رغم پیشرفت‌های فناوری، چالش‌هایی هم در حوزه سیستم‌های ورود و عضویت وجود دارد، از جمله:
- حفظ حریم خصوصی: درخواست اطلاعات زیاد ممکن است باعث نگرانی کاربران شود. راه‌حل، جمع‌آوری فقط داده‌های ضروری و رعایت کامل مقررات حفاظت از داده‌ها است.
- پایداری و کاربرپسندی: سیستم باید سریع، ساده، و قابل اعتماد باشد. پیچیدگی زیاد یا کند بودن، باعث کاهش رضایت کاربر می‌شود.
- مقاومت در برابر حملات: حملات مکرر، نیازمند راهکارهای پیشرفته امنیتی و مانیتورینگ است تا سیستم آسیب‌پذیر نباشد.
- پشتیبانی از دستگاه‌ها و مرورگرهای مختلف: سیستم باید در تمامی دستگاه‌ها و مرورگرهای رایج به خوبی کار کند، بدون اینکه امنیت یا کارایی آن کاهش یابد.
نتیجه‌گیری
در نهایت، سیستم‌های ورود و عضویت، قلب تپنده هر سرویس آنلاین هستند که بدون آن‌ها، ارتباط امن و موثر با کاربران غیرممکن است. پیاده‌سازی یک سیستم قوی، امن، و کاربرپسند، نیازمند طراحی هوشمندانه، رعایت استانداردهای امنیتی، و توجه مداوم به نیازهای کاربران است. با توجه به روند رو به رشد فناوری‌های بیومتریک و احراز هویت چندعاملی، آینده این سیستم‌ها بسیار امیدوارکننده است و به سمت امنیت بیشتر و تجربه کاربری بهتر حرکت می‌کند. در این مسیر، شرکت‌ها و توسعه‌دهندگان باید همواره بر چالش‌های جدید فائق آیند و راهکارهای نوآورانه را در طراحی سیستم‌های ورود و عضویت خود به کار گیرند.
مشاهده بيشتر